Use this set of wildcard characters when you use the find and replace dialog box to find and optionally replace data in an access database or an access project. Displays a list of special characters for which you can search: A tab character, a manual line break, an optional hyphen, or any characterâ€also known as a wildcard.

To locate a specific item when you can't remember exactly how it is spelled, try using a wildcard character in a query.
